Output ce77a17f2b18f3b4e111e69d795a2497f431abb30ebde0b5c34cc2980ad96d74:0

value
6951289743367
script pubkey
OP_0 OP_PUSHBYTES_20 59c7a7f57005381d685504bf8157cd394d75e1b6
address
tb1qt8r60atsq5up66z4qjlcz47d89xhtcdk3jf0mg
transaction
ce77a17f2b18f3b4e111e69d795a2497f431abb30ebde0b5c34cc2980ad96d74
confirmations
166530
spent
true